Huicong Jia is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Atmospheric Science and Ecology. According to data from OpenAlex, Huicong Jia has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 883 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 11 papers in Atmospheric Science and 9 papers in Ecology. Recurrent topics in Huicong Jia’s work include Flood Risk Assessment and Management (10 papers), Global Drought Monitoring and Assessment (9 papers) and Climate change impacts on agriculture (8 papers). Huicong Jia is often cited by papers focused on Flood Risk Assessment and Management (10 papers), Global Drought Monitoring and Assessment (9 papers) and Climate change impacts on agriculture (8 papers). Huicong Jia coll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Huicong Jia's co-authors include Jing’ai Wang, Donghua Pan, Hongjian Zhou, Jinhong Wan, Fang Chen, Wanchang Zhang, Lei Wang, Aqiang Yang, Chunxiang Cao and Ning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Remote Sensing of Environment and IEEE Transactions on Geoscience and Remote Sensing.
